Friday, 2019-10-04

*** raukadah is now known as chandankumar05:13
*** zbr is now known as zbr|ruck08:23
*** zbr|ruck is now known as zbr|lunch11:15
*** EmilienM has quit IRC11:53
*** EmilienM has joined #openstack-ansible-sig11:54
*** zbr|lunch is now known as zbr|ruck13:25
mnasero/14:01
mnaser#startmeeting ansible_sig14:01
openstackMeeting started Fri Oct  4 14:01:23 2019 UTC and is due to finish in 60 minutes.  The chair is mnaser. Information about MeetBot at http://wiki.debian.org/MeetBot.14:01
openstackUseful Commands: #action #agreed #help #info #idea #link #topic #startvote.14:01
*** openstack changes topic to " (Meeting topic: ansible_sig)"14:01
openstackThe meeting name has been set to 'ansible_sig'14:01
mnaseranyone around? :)14:01
mnaseri had a few things to dsiscuss14:01
mnaserwelp, perhaps someone will follow up on this later14:02
cloudnullo/14:03
mnaseri actually was hoping to discuss https://review.opendev.org/#/c/684740/114:03
mnaseri spoke a bit with mordred at ansiblefest and we thought now that everything is becoming a collection14:03
mnaserand that we can host things whereever we want, it might be a good target for it to live htere14:04
mnaserand then we can use gerrit and i think most people here are interested in making sure these modules work in some way or another14:04
cloudnullthats cool, and a good idea imo14:04
mnaseri personally cant stand the current github workflow14:05
mnaserits quite unmotivating to do reviews tbh14:05
mnaseri think mordred also pushed up an initial patch14:05
mnaserhttps://review.opendev.org/#/q/project:openstack/ansible-collections-openstack14:06
mnaserwe might need some help in adding some jobs to that, i guesws14:06
mnaseri think right now we need at last some base zuul jobs for collections14:11
mnaseri think i can try helping with some of those14:11
cloudnullsorry in double meetings :)14:28
mnaseryeah, maybe we need to revisit the time of this14:37
cloudnullI normally dont have a conflict at thisi time14:49
cloudnullbut ++ It would seem most folks are AFK :(14:50
* mordred waves to mnaser and cloudnull14:50
mnaseroh yay hi14:50
cloudnullo/14:50
* mordred is excited about our new home for ansible-collections-openstack14:50
mordredneeds to add jobs14:50
mnaseryeah, i think jobs are the thing we need right now, but i dont think there's an established pattern of testing collections14:51
mnaserso we may be in uncharted territory..14:51
mordredyeah. on the other hand - we do have an test job in sdk for testing some ansible playbooks and stuff14:51
mordredso I was thinking of starting with that and seeing how far we got14:52
mnaseri guess we have to write something to 'build' the collection and then 'plop it in'14:52
mordredyah - ansible-galaxy collection build makes a tarball, then you can ansible-galaxy collection install my-tarball.tgz14:52
mordredso it shouldn't be *too* hard14:53
mnaserfamous last words14:53
mordredmight be nice to make a role in zuul-jobs for "install this collection in this directory over here"14:53
mordredand a basic base job14:53
mnaseryes thats kinda what i was hoping to be able to do, a base job for ansible collections14:54
mnaserbut yeah a role makes sense initially14:54
mnaserlike "get me an ansible and prepare it to test $this_dir"14:54
cloudnullin tripleo-ansible we're using a lot of molecule based testing for our roles, plugins, and playbooks. There may be some bits we can crib from there?14:55
cloudnullwe're not using the tox-molecule, largely due to it requiring docker. the TripleO-Ansible base job is just a basic runner so just about any molecule driver will work.14:57
cloudnull** the tox-molecule job found in zuul14:57
*** chandankumar is now known as raukadah14:57
mordrednod. I haven't done much with molecule yet - largely because IIRC it seems to want to manage test ends for you still ... but I should probably learn about it at some poitn14:58
cloudnullit seems to work pretty well these days.15:07
cloudnullthe delegated driver (local test) works really well in zuulci.15:08
cloudnullthe docker/podman drivers work well too, provide nice coverage for multiple Operating systems in a single test run, but are impractical for types of tests.15:09
cloudnull** for some types of tests15:09
mnaser#endmeeting15:17
*** openstack changes topic to "OpenStack Ansible SIG | https://etherpad.openstack.org/p/ansible-sig"15:17
openstackMeeting ended Fri Oct  4 15:17:37 2019 UTC.  Information about MeetBot at http://wiki.debian.org/MeetBot . (v 0.1.4)15:17
openstackMinutes:        http://eavesdrop.openstack.org/meetings/ansible_sig/2019/ansible_sig.2019-10-04-14.01.html15:17
openstackMinutes (text): http://eavesdrop.openstack.org/meetings/ansible_sig/2019/ansible_sig.2019-10-04-14.01.txt15:17
openstackLog:            http://eavesdrop.openstack.org/meetings/ansible_sig/2019/ansible_sig.2019-10-04-14.01.log.html15:17
*** zbr|ruck has quit IRC16:39
*** zbr has joined #openstack-ansible-sig16:51
*** zbr has quit IRC19:46
*** EmilienM is now known as EvilienM20:18
*** EvilienM is now known as containerizes_hi20:19
*** containerizes_hi is now known as containerized20:19
*** containerized is now known as EvilienM20:19
*** EvilienM is now known as EmilienM21:52

Generated by irclog2html.py 2.15.3 by Marius Gedminas - find it at mg.pov.lt!